What's The Definition Of Thermosetting?

thermosetting in American English
becoming permanently hard and rigid when once subjected to heat
adjective: pertaining to a type of plastic, as the urea resins, that sets when heated and cannot be remolded

thermosetting in British English
adjective: (of a material, esp a synthetic plastic or resin) hardening permanently after one application of heat and pressure. Thermosetting plastics, such as phenol-formaldehyde, cannot be remoulded
